Since you are likely now quite intrigued, allow me to provide you with some details. The Melting Pot restaurants in OKC and Tulsa are hosting week-long Father’s Day specials from June 14-20. For $50, plus tax and tip, you get a three course fondue paired with beer from Marshall.
-Course 1: Cheddar cheese fondue with Old Pavilion Pilsner
-Course 2: Garlic chili chicken, citrus pork tenderloin, spicy shrimp and spinach-Gorgonzola ravioli with a sriracha aioli sauce with Atlas India Pale Ale
-Course 3: White chocolate butterscotch fondue with McNellie’s Pub Ale
Wes and Marshall brewmaster Eric Marshall will attend special dinner presentations from 6 to 8 p.m. June 16 at the OKC location and June 17 at the Tulsa location. Diners are invited to visit with Wes and Eric to talk about the beers and the pairings. Reservations are recommended for the June 16 and 17 dinners.
